    Here's a couple of pics of the 'MY12' seals on my car. The first pic is it in place... the 2010 seals if I remember correctly are glued below what you see to the sill side though I can't remember how it was rooted around the door. The dealer changed mine because I was getting water ingress and the sill top was getting very wet whenever it rained hard? The problem I have with the 'MY12 seals is that the sill ridge/groove (?) isn't deep enough to hold the seal in place so it just comes away usually when you are getting in and out (second pic). I'm just working on a solution to ensure its fixed into place...

  4. My 2010 Evora has the '12MY onwards door seals, but the way the seal is attached looks bodged. The seal is fixed to a long piece of plastic which in turn is fastened to the paintwork via several strips of black sticky adhesive. Anyway, I'm trying to clean it all up and fix it better.. the Lotus recommended adhesive cleaner is 'Betaclean 3900' but costs £121.83 from Lotus which strikes me as a tad expensive, but I can't seem to find it anywhere else. Has anyone used an effective adhesive cleaner to get rid of what seems to be fairly heavy duty adhesive, but is kind to paintwork!
